This is an early 19th century Mexican San Sebastian in carved wood, gessoed and polychrome painted. It has glass eyes and rugged unshaven look about him. This is a large size and has a high quality workmanship. Arrows piercing his body, ropes and his halo are missing. All fingers on both hands are complete. Altogether a fine piece with minor paint losses.
Dimensions: 14” high (bottom of base to top of tree) X 7” wide X 5” deep base. 13” high (bottom of base to top of head)
